im thinking about setting up a nano tank. and was wondering if anyone has used CPR aquatics nano line? they look like good quality for the price.
 
well yes plus they have hang on back refug, skimmers,lights, tanks, was thinking going full cpr but theres not a lot of reviews out there.

Gotcha, I've had the medium HOB refugium. It worked great, the only issue i had was the weight, so i built a small 2X4 brace behind my stand to support it. I'm using the CPR media reactor now and its awesome. The RIO pumps that come with them aren't anything special, but the reactor itself has a very small footprint and works well. In regards to CPR, I guess it depends on what you need and what your limitations are.
